7+ SENATE RESOLUTION
28 WHEREAS, The Senate of the State of Texas is pleased to
39 welcome the citizens of Mission who are gathering in Austin in
410 celebration of Mission Day at the Texas Capitol on February 18,
511 2025; and
612 WHEREAS, Mission has been one of the foremost commercial
713 and agricultural hubs along the Texas border since the city was
814 founded in 1908, the year the Missouri Pacific Railroad
915 established a station in the area; and
1016 WHEREAS, Known as the home of the grapefruit, Mission has a
1117 proud history of citrus-fruit farming since the first citrus
1218 trees in the Rio Grande Valley were planted in the Mission area;
1319 once a year, citizens come together at the Texas Citrus Fiesta to
1420 celebrate their town's contributions to the multimillion-dollar
1521 citrus industry; and
1622 WHEREAS, A center for tourism and exchange between the
1723 United States and Mexico, Mission boasts a flourishing economy
1824 that has attracted agriculture associations, technology firms,
1925 and international manufacturers; the Center for Education and
2026 Economic Development, a business incubator and co-working
2127 facility, has been instrumental in diversifying the local
2228 economy and generating local business growth; and
2329 WHEREAS, In addition to industrial development, Mission
2430 offers a pleasant climate and beautiful natural surroundings to
2531 its 86,000 residents and thousands of seasonal visitors who spend
2632 the winter in Mission's many RV parks; locals and visitors enjoy
2733 such attractions as Mission's National Butterfly Center, the
2834 World Birding Center headquarters, the Bentsen-Rio Grande Valley
2935 State Park, and the Mission hike and bike trails; and
3036 WHEREAS, Mission has been depicted in literature and
3137 popular culture as the iconic setting of Larry McMurtry's classic
3238 Western novel Lonesome Dove and its adapted television
3339 miniseries; Mission is also noted as the home of such prominent
3440 politicians and other well-known figures as United States
3541 Senator Lloyd Bentsen, Congressman Kika de la Garza, and
3642 legendary Dallas Cowboys coach Tom Landry; and
3743 WHEREAS, The people of Mission are justifiably proud of
3844 their city for its cultural heritage and unique offerings, and
3945 Mission Day at the Capitol is truly a fitting opportunity to
4046 honor the City of Mission and its residents; now, therefore, be
4147 it
4248 R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 89th
4349 Legislature, hereby commend the citizens of Mission on their
4450 important contributions to the history and prosperity of our
4551 state and extend to them best wishes for a memorable Mission Day
4652 at the Capitol; and, be it further
4753 R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ared in
4854 honor of this special occasion.
